A metal tank contains air at 20 C and 400 kPa. The tank volume is 5 m3 . It is connected through a valve to another tank containing 7 kg of air at 40 C and 300 kPa. After 10 minutes, the valve is opened, and the whole system will reach thermal equilibrium with the surroundings (T= 25 C). Determine the volume of the second tank and the final pressure of air. Explain the relationships between system constants for a perfect gas.
